Thomas Rhett Drops New Single, Two 2022 Albums in the Works

Thomas Rhett has just released his latest single, “Slow Down Summer,” a ballad co-written with Rhett Akins, his father, as well as Sean Douglas, Jesse Frasure, and Ashley Gorley.  

“I wrote this song from the point of view of two people who are in love during senior year of high school,” Rhett explains about the song. “I envisioned them headed off to different schools and they’re starting to understand that the moment the weather starts to change, they’ve got a 99-percent chance this relationship is not going to work. I know that myself and a lot of people have been there before, wishing the fireworks stage doesn’t have to end.”

Rhett has announced to fans that the track is the premiere single from his sixth album Where We Started which is expected to release early next year. The country star won’t be stopping there, though, as he is also planning to complete a continuation of his Country Again album from 2021, a project called Side B
